Dale, > Complete conditionalization of Dwarf reg numbers. This looks pretty hackish. The numbers used before were definitely correct for x86-32/linux. I dunno about darwin, but it looks like "turning everything on darwin to be default implementation" is not a good approach. :)
And, if you need to conditionalize depending on target, table approach (like in i386.h) will be definitely better, otherwise we'll end with spaghetti-like code, when all supported targets will be in place. -- With best regards, Anton Korobeynikov.
